Inspector Trainee Opportunity
The trainee position is an entry-level training position for one year during which development to complete these duties and responsibilities occurs. At that time an evaluation will determine if the employee retains employment as an Inspector.
- Work alongside an HWAP Inspector to conduct daily HWAP inspections as required by the Program Director
- Attend and successfully complete all required classes and training necessary for HWAP Inspector Certification
- Performs HWAP data entry as required
- Work alongside an HWAP Inspector to prepare, issue, and maintain HWAP work orders and files for HWAP contracted services
- Monitor quality of workmanship and materials of HWAP contracted service

EPP Auditor Opportunity
The EPP Auditors will meter all electric appliances and log information into the computer, review the data, and have
customers sign off on measures in order to provide program benefits. The EPP auditor will also replace all eligible light
bulbs with energy-efficient LED bulbs.
The EPP auditor candidate must have…
- Ability to use math skill for measuring and calculating data
- Proficient computer skills
- Familiarity of Microsoft Office programs
- The aptitude to conduct testing on electric appliances
- The capability to write specifications as required by program
- The capacity to communicate effectively verbally and in writing
- Outstanding customer service

Mahoning Youngstown Community Action Partnership is seeking the following contractors interested in work by subcontract under the Home Weatherization Assistance Program (HWAP).
- Electrical
- HVAC
- Insulation
- Plumbing
- Roofing
Interested contractors must show proof of insurance, bonding, independent BWC coverage, EPA LEAD firm certification form, state license when necessary and ownership of appropriate equipment. Contractors must be willing to complete, and pass required training (if applicable), hold appropriate certifications and follow a Schedule A pricing list.
Minority Business Enterprises and EDGE businesses will be offered full opportunity to submit proposals and will not be subjected to discrimination on the basis of race, color, sex or national origin in consideration of any contract.
